By far the most interesting and distinguished figure in the life of the Abbey after the Conquest was the historian, William of Malmesbury.
Tony McAleavy tells the story of his life: from his childhood as a boy-monk in Malmesbury to his glittering career as a prolific writer favoured by royalty.
William lived at an interesting time and witnessed both the building of Malmesbury Castle and the demolition of the Anglo-Saxon Abbey. Tony’s talk will explore the scale of William’s achievements, his personality and the world in which he lived.

After decades of devastating raids, Viking armies first overwintered in England in 850. In doing so, they opened a century of conflict and reaching ambition.
In Norway, Harald Fairhair rose from a regional chieftain to become its first king, while in England Alfred the Great preserved Wessex from conquest and laid the foundations for unity. His successors extended that vision, leading to the creation of a single English kingdom after Athelstan’s decisive victory at Brunanburh in 937.
